In case anyone hadn't played my entry yet, I'll give ya some things about it. In the second room, there's a gimmick where sprites can pass through some of the castle blocks and Mario can't, and at the end the blocks will fall if you touch one of them. And in the boss room, I didn't used any ExGFX, you will be given a hint before it (I've never seen anyone using this gimmick before (The one where the P-switch is moved by layer 2 blocks around it), aside from some people using the rope tileset). I didn't think it's that hard, Kaizo difficult there. I've not made any use of Super GFX Bypass.

Originally posted by bbk61
I dont know why but a week ago I used a xkas patch. But I deleted it with AntiXkas shortly after. Is this going to be a problem?

You can just export the mwl files and load them up in a new ROM. It's still vanilla, so it shouldn't be an issue to just move levels like that between them.
